GlobalFoundries says it will spend $4B+ to build a chipmaking plant in Singapore, starting production in 2023, and devote $1B each to its German and US sites — - The U.S.-based firm says it will begin production in 2023 — TSMC's smaller rival expands in Asia as chip crunch persists
